在当今这个数字化时代,移动设备已经成为了我们生活中不可或缺的一部分,随着智能手机的普及和移动互联网的发展,通过手机进行购物已经成为了一种趋势,对于一些开发者来说,如何有效地模拟手机购物场景,以便于测试、开发和优化应用程序,仍然是一个挑战,本文将探讨如何利用服务器技术来模拟手机购物环境,并提供一系列解决方案。
随着移动互联网的快速发展,越来越多的消费者选择使用手机进行购物,为了满足这一需求,许多电商平台纷纷推出了手机端应用,由于硬件设备的多样性以及网络环境的复杂性,开发者在测试这些应用时往往面临诸多困难,如何构建一个稳定且高效的手机购物模拟环境成为了一个亟待解决的问题。
手机购物模拟环境的必要性
-
性能优化: 通过模拟不同的网络环境和硬件配置,可以更准确地评估应用的性能表现,从而进行针对性的优化。
图片来源于网络,如有侵权联系删除
-
用户体验提升: 模拟各种操作场景可以帮助开发者更好地理解用户的实际体验,进而改进界面设计和交互流程。
-
安全性保障: 在线支付等敏感操作需要确保数据的安全传输和处理,模拟环境有助于发现潜在的安全漏洞并进行修复。
-
多平台兼容性: 不同品牌的手机操作系统可能存在差异,模拟环境能够帮助开发者验证应用的跨平台兼容性。
服务器模拟手机购物的实现方法
-
虚拟化技术: 利用虚拟机或容器技术创建多个独立的模拟环境,每个环境都可以运行在不同的操作系统上,以模拟不同型号的手机。
-
云服务提供商: 使用像Amazon Web Services(AWS)、Microsoft Azure这样的云计算服务平台来托管模拟环境,这样可以轻松地扩展资源和调整配置。
-
自动化工具: 采用如Selenium WebDriver等自动化测试框架,编写脚本自动执行各种购物流程,包括浏览商品、添加到购物车、结账等。
案例分享——某电商平台的手机购物模拟系统
-
项目背景: 该电商平台希望为其移动应用提供一个统一的测试平台,以便快速响应市场变化和提高产品质量。
图片来源于网络,如有侵权联系删除
-
解决方案: 他们选择了AWS EC2实例作为基础架构,并结合了Selenium WebDriver来实现自动化测试,还引入了JMeter来进行负载测试,以确保在高并发情况下系统能够正常运行。
-
效果评估: 经过一段时间的实施,该平台的移动应用在性能、安全性和用户体验方面都有了显著提升,同时也缩短了新版本发布的周期。
未来发展趋势预测
-
边缘计算的应用: 随着物联网技术的发展,边缘计算将在手机购物模拟环境中发挥越来越重要的作用,使得数据处理更加高效和实时。
-
人工智能技术的融合: 利用机器学习和深度学习算法,可以对用户行为进行分析,从而为个性化推荐和服务提供支持。
-
区块链技术的引入: 区块链技术在保证交易安全和隐私保护方面的优势,有望在未来应用于手机购物领域,提高信任度和透明度。
服务器模拟手机购物是当前数字经济发展中的一个重要课题,通过采用先进的技术手段和方法,可以有效解决传统测试方式带来的问题,为企业带来更多的商业机会和创新动力,展望未来,我们有理由相信,随着科技的不断进步,手机购物模拟环境将会变得更加智能、便捷和安全。
标签: #服务器模拟手机购物
评论列表